slide-in camper

I'm shoping around for a nice used slide-in camper for my '04 F350. I have the camper pkg, correct wheel/tires and the short bed. I'm not looking for a palace - just your basic comfortable camper to use a few weeks a year. Looking for some web resources and floor plans - have seen one or two on ebay but they are junk. Suggestions?

If you can find one, Alaskan Campers are the very best you can get. They are telescopic, and travel low, then electically telescope up when you want them to. That way you have the best of both worlds; something that will not cause too much drag, and something with a good amount of room when ready to camp. Another good one is the one I have, made by Hallmark, out of Brighton CO, they make a pop up camper, now electric operation, though mine is push up. I love the thing and it sits low onto my truck, so does not much effect the fuel mileage.
